Kylie Minogue looked effortlessly chic as she stepped out on Wednesday for a night on the town at London's Chiltern Firehouse.
The Australian pop icon, 55, was the epitome of chic as she wore a stunning pale pink silk co-ord during the outing.
Showcasing her petite frame, she cinched in her waist with her trench coat buckled belt, teamed with a matching pair of trendy flared trousers.
Opting for comfort, Kylie left her stilettos at home and chose distressed light brown leather boots.
Adding a touch of sparkle to her look, The Loco-Motion star accessorised her ensemble with a gold cross-body bag.
Kylie Minogue, 55, looked effortlessly chic in a fabulous salmon-pink silk cord as she stepped out on Wednesday for a night on the town at London's Chiltern Firehouse
The Australian pop icon showcased her petite frame as she cinched in her waist with her trench coat buckled belt.
Her stylish outing comes just days after it was revealed that she is pouring her heart into her 17th studio album, which has been teased to be filled with mega dance tracks.
The pop star is also set to release her highly anticipated No1 record Tension, which will include new tunes, a testament to her continued musical prowess.
A source told The Sun: 'Kylie has made it clear to her team this is no time to slow down. Plans are already in motion for the next two albums, one of which will be a repackage of Tension with additional songs.
'As for the direction of album 17 it's early days — but a full-on dance album is in the works.
'The plan is to release the Tension repackage towards the end of the year, with probably up to five new tracks.'
MailOnline contacted Kylie's representatives for comment at the time.
Last month, Kylie hit the studio in California with chart-topping British DJ Joel Corry, who previously gushed it would 'be an honour' to work with the Spinning Around songstress.
